I use the iwl3945 driver on a Thinkpad R60.
The commands
"modprobe iwl3945
sleep 1
iwconfig wlan0 essid any
iwconfig wlan0 key off
iwconfig wlan0 mode Managed
ip link set wlan0 up
dhclient wlan0"
worked fine with kernels 2.6.22 and 26.24.
But with 2.6.25 I could not get a connection.
I attach the relevant part of the syslog.
It does not contain any hint.
The scan-command "iwlist wlan0 scan" works
fine, as with the older kernels.

linux-2.6 (2.6.26-1) unstable; urgency=low
.
* New upstream release see http://kernelnewbies.org/Linux_2_6_26
- UDF 2.50 support. (closes: #480910)
- mmc: increase power up delay (closes: #481190)
- snd-hda-intel suspend troubles fixed. (closes: #469727, #481613, #480034)
- cifs QueryUnixPathInfo fix (closes: #480995)
- r8169 oops in r8169_get_mac_version (closes: #471892)
- netfilter headers cleanup (closes: #482331)
- iwlwifi led support (closes: #469095)
- ath5k associates on AR5213A (closes: #463785)
- T42 suspend fix (closes: #485873)
- cpuidle acpi driver: fix oops on AC<->DC (closes: #477201)
- opti621 ide fixes (closes: #475561)
- ssh connection hangs with mac80211 (closes: #486089)
- ocfs2: Allow uid/gid/perm changes of symlinks (closes: #479475)
- xircom_tulip_cb: oboslete driver removed (closes: #416900)
- r8169 properly detect link status (closes: #487586)
- iwl3945 connection + support fixes (closes: #481436, #482196)
- longrun cpufreq min freq fix (closes: #468149)
- emux midi synthesizer SOFT_PEDAL-release event (closes: #474312)
- vmemmap fixes to use smaller pages (closes: #483489)
- x86 freeze fixes (closes: #482100, #482074)
- xen boot failure fix (closes: #488284)
- gdb read floating-point and SSE registers (closes: #485375)
- USB_PERSIST is default on (closes: #489963)
- alsa snd-hda Dell Inspiron fix (closes: #490649)
- ipw2200: queue direct scans (closes: #487721)
- better gcc-4.3 support (closes: #492301)
- iwl3945 monitor mode. (closes: #482387)
